What it's like to be a Biofuels Operations Coordinator
As a Biofuels Operations Coordinator, you support biofuel production operations by coordinating schedules, managing logistics, and providing administrative support. You're ensuring feedstock arrivals align with production, tracking fuel shipments, and keeping operations running smoothly.
Your day supports the production cycle. You might coordinate feedstock deliveries, then schedule outbound fuel shipments, then track inventory, then communicate with vendors, then support production scheduling. You're the coordinator who keeps information flowing and logistics organized.
The hardest part is managing variability in a commodity-driven business. Feedstock prices and availability fluctuate; production adjusts accordingly. You need flexibility while maintaining organization. The people who thrive here are organized, adaptable, and interested in renewable energy.
